Interactive Learning in an ALC: 'These rooms invite students to collaborate'
If you have a class where you want students to collaborate, you can consider booking an Active Learning Classroom. These flexible educational spaces in Leiden and The Hague are designed to make lectures more interactive.

Alumnus Marit Brun makes travel guides with a nod to anthropology
Anthropologist Marit Brun captured Leiden’s student life during her studies, which won her the ‘Best Leiden photo’ competition. She now wants to continue with photography and making travel guides with a nod to anthropology.
